Sports games have gradually been getting alternative contexts to try and appeal to a wider range of gamers. The fact of the matter is that not everyone cares about the NFL, MLB, NBA, NHL, or any other acronymized professional sports league. But that doesn't mean that the rules of these respective sports don't translate well into video games because that is certainly not the case. HyperBrawl Tournament looks to capitalize on this growing trend with an alternative take on Handball.
HyperBrawl Tournament brings together great warriors to compete in a once-in-a-century tournament where teams face off in a PvP Combat-style arena where the goal is to pummel your opponents, grab the ball, and score. The game is inspired by the likes of Rocket League which helped fuel this trend with its fast-paced multiplayer and combat/sports hybrid gameplay.
